Highlights
Are people in Boynton Beach older or younger than people in Armonk?
- The Median Age in Boynton Beach is 1.5 years younger than in Armonk.

Are housing costs cheaper in Boynton Beach or Armonk?
- Boynton Beach housing costs are 58.4% less expensive than Armonk hous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Boynton Beach or Armonk?
- The average commute for residents of Boynton Beach is 7.9 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Armonk.

Things to do in Armonk?
Living in Armonk, NY is a wonderful experience. It is a charming village with small-town charm and big city amenities. The town offers a variety of activities such as hiking, biking and skiing, as well as many local attractions such as the Sleepy Hollow Country Club and the North Castle Historical Society. There are plenty of shops, restaurants, and entertainment venues to explore. Residents also enjoy access to excellent schools, parks, and public transportation. Overall Armonk is a great place to live with something for everyone!
